본문 바로가기

Front-End/JavaScript5

Learn JavaScript_Arrays let newYearsResolutions = ['Keep a journal', 'Take a falconry class', 'Learn to juggle']; 자바스크립트 배열 ∘ let으로 정의된 array는 reassign 될 수 있음 ∘ const array는 배열 내의 요소를 바꿀 수는 있지만 배열 전체를 새로 정의할 수는 없음 ∘ 배열.push(요소1, 요소2, ...) : 배열에 1개 이상의 요소 추가 ∘ 배열.pop() : 배열의 마지막 요소 삭제 ∘ 배열.pop()을 부르는 것만으로도 실행돼서 배열의 마지막 요소가 삭제됨 ∘ 배열.shift() : 배열의 첫번째 요소 삭제 ∘ 배열.unshift(요소) : 배열의 가장 앞부분에 요소 추가 ∘ 배열.slice(첫번째 요소 번호, 마지막 요소.. 2022. 7. 20.
Learn JavaScript_Conditionals ∘ Math.round() : 반올림 ∘ Math.ceil() : 올림 ∘ Math.floor() : 내림 Magic Eight Ball let userName = 'J'; userName ? console.log(`Hello, ${userName}`) : console.log('Hello!'); let userQuestion = 'Will I adopt a new puppy soon?'; console.log(`${userName} has asked - ${userQuestion}`); let randomNumber = Math.floor(Math.random() * 8); let eightBall = ''; switch (eightBall){ case 0 : eightBall = 'It is cert.. 2022. 7. 14.
Learn JavaScript_Introduction Kelvin Weather //Current temperature in kelvin degrees. const kelvin = 0; //Convert kelvin to celsius const celsius = kelvin-273; //Convert celsius to fahrenheit let fahrenheit = celsius * (9/5) + 32; //Round down fahrenheit variable fahrenheit = Math.floor(fahrenheit); console.log(`The temperature is ${fahrenheit} degrees Fahrenheit.`); let newton = celsius * (33/100); newton = Math.floor(newto.. 2022. 7. 14.
자바스크립트의 시작-웹과 Javascript 코드 javascript 코드임을 웹브라우저에게 알려줌 document.write(’출력 내용’) 웹페이지에 어떤 글씨 출력할 때 onclick 클릭했을 때 onclick 버튼 클릭했을 때 경고창 뜨게 하려면 input 태그 안에 onclick=alert(’경고문’) onchange 내용이 변했을 때 onkeydown 키보드 키를 눌렀을 때 alert(’내용’) 내용을 알림으로 띄움 alert(1+1); 경고창에 2가 출력됨 “문자열” 또는 ‘문자열’ 쓰면 됨 ‘문자열’.length 내용의 글자 수 ‘문자열’.toUpperCase() 문자열을 대문자로 변환 ‘문자열’.indexOf(’찾으려는 것’) 문자열에서 찾으려는 것이 몇 번째에 나오는지 알려줌. 0,1,2, ...번째라고 알려줌. 문자 한 개를 찾.. 2022. 3. 27.
자바스크립트의 실행 방법과 실습 환경 Javascript 파일 만들기 Windows 메모장에 코드 작성 → 저장 누름 → '파일 이름' 끝에 .html 붙임 → 파일 형식은 '텍스트 문서'가 아닌 '모든 파일'로 선택 → '인코딩'은 'UTF-8' 선택 → 저장 파일 실행 브라우저에서 'ctrl'+'O' 누름 → 열려는 파일 선택 → 실행됨 파일 만들지 않고 브라우저에 내장된 콘솔을 이용하여 Javascript를 실행하기 크롬 개발자 도구 이용 'F12' 눌러서(또는 맨오른쪽위에 '설정' 누르고 '도구 더보기'에서 '개발자 도구' 눌러서) 크롬 개발자 도구 엶 → 콘솔 창 엶 → 콘솔 창에 html 코드를 작성할 필요 없이 javascript 코드를 작성 → 코드 작성 후 'Enter' 누름 → 실행됨 (긴 코드는 파일 작성이 편리할 것) .. 2022. 3. 27.